From 2816a09678f50fc6a69e742e90cb1fd7a9f1f9ff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Luís Henriques Date: Fri, 8 Sep 2023 12:20:20 +0100 Subject: ceph: remove unnecessary check for NULL in parse_longname() M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Function ceph_get_inode() never returns NULL; instead it returns an ERR_PTR() if something fails. Thus, the check for NULL in parse_longname() is useless and can be dropped. Instead, move there the debug code that does the error checking so that it's only executed if ceph_get_inode() is called.
